Step 6: Deploy the Lanternfish image-cache fix. The leak came from evicted thumbnails keeping decoder handles alive; the patch releases them on eviction. For the security review, note the cache now reports metrics to the Oxbow telemetry endpoint, which requires an authenticated client. Add the credential on the following line of the .env file.

vault entry, yahif-yajep: COURIER_KEY29=b802bdf8034096b65a51c6ba5abe2

## Parcel Webhook (Swiftmoor)

If Swiftmoor tracking updates stall, check the webhook receiver first. Failed deliveries retry three times, then park in the dead-letter bin. Replay from the Ketterly console only after confirming the receiver is healthy. Do not edit settings live. The receiver's current configuration is shown below.

settings of tagef-bawif:
DRUIX_HOST=druix.zemvarlabs.internal
DRUIX_PORT=8000

**Building Access — Loading Dock (Verner House)**

The loading dock on Hartley Lane accepts deliveries Monday to Friday, 07:00–15:30. Team assistants expecting large shipments should book a slot through the Facilities calendar at least one day ahead; unbooked couriers may be turned away during peak hours. Out-of-hours deliveries require prior approval from the building manager. To open the dock's side entry door, enter the code below.

badge for fafop-fajof: bdg-Z-47

TICKET: Config hot-reload drops TLS settings on Quillgate edge nodes. Repro: push any change via Fenwick console; reload fires, but cert paths revert to defaults until full restart. Started after the watcher refactor. Impact: intermittent handshake failures in the Dorvane region. Workaround: restart the proxy after each config push. On-call: do not push config changes until patched. Fix is in review; verify against the token below.

pipeline stamp: htk9_ce63042d9